A town founded as a copper, gold, and silver mining town in 1880 and named after Judge Dewitt Bisbee, a financial backer of the area's Copper Queen Mine, the largest claim at the time. Famous copper mining district. The old town was bisected by the Lavender open pit mine and highway 80 runs between the sections, alongside the pit. Old town Bisbee is now a tourist attraction and arts community. The Copper Queen Hotel in the old town is reputedly a haunted building.

New Bisbee is a more recent development S of the old town along highway 92 and the Mexican border. It is the home of the county seat offices.

A selection of classic Bisbee minerals was one of the many displays at the Tucson Gem and Mineral Show 2008.


Onac (2025) mentions chalcophanite, cuprite, plattnerite, tenorite, bromargyrite, azurite, malachite, rosasite, chalcanthite, mimetite, and shattuckite to occur in "Bisbee mine caves".
